Mary Ann Evans Hospice is an adult community hospice in North Warwickshire. As an independent charity, we provide palliative and end-of-life care and support to patients with life-limiting illnesses and those that matter most to them.
Our services include Hospice at Home, Wellbeing Centre, Family Support and Bereavement, Lymphoedema Care, and Rapid Response (a shared service with South Warwickshire NHS Foundation Trust). We work closely with our community and hospital colleagues from the NHS, social services, local care homes, and other voluntary providers. Our care is compassionate and inclusive for all who access our services.
